Sector: TECHNOLOGY
Industry: SEMICONDUCTORS
Power Integrations, Inc. (POWI) is a leading designer and manufacturer of high-performance mixed signal and analog integrated circuits (ICs) that facilitate efficient power conversion across a variety of applications worldwide. Headquartered in San Jose, California, the company leverages its innovative technologies to address the growing demand for energy-efficient solutions in sectors such as consumer electronics, telecommunications, and renewable energy. With a strong commitment to sustainability, Power Integrations focuses on delivering products that not only enhance performance but also reduce environmental impact, positioning itself as a key player in the global semiconductor industry.
